Rogue-likes are a dime a dozen, but it’s rare that one catches the attention of a larger community the way Hades did, with players still finding new ways to engage with the game. One specific run in the title, known as the Hades 64 Heat Unseeded, was previously thought to be unbeatable due to the difficulty, but one user has seemingly beaten it to the surprise of everyone.

The run was beaten by a user on YouTube who goes by Jade and looks to have taken around 30 minutes to completely best. It’s unclear how or if this will be verified, but it’s certainly impressive that it has been beaten when some users were speculating that it was unbeatable just a week ago. It is considered especially difficult due to the highest level of heat, but Jade took that as a beatable challenge.

YouTube video

The 64 Heat in the challenge name refers to the heat gauge in Hades, which serves as the difficulty meter of the game when players are able to set custom parameters. It’s the hardest the game can be unmodded, so many expected that it was completely unbeatable by anyone without altering the game. As usual, this was likely shared in Hades fan communities, which answered the challenge in force.

Not only were they able to beat the game mode, but they did so in half an hour. For a mode that was considered unbeatable in a game that is difficult on its own, it’s incredibly impressive that someone was able to accomplish this in such a short amount of time.

    Some context and corrections: Jade AKA Angel1c has been a Hades runner for over 2 years. She has over 3000 hours of experience running the game, most of which is high heat. She has held high heat world records for every single aspect (weapon variations, of which 24 exist) in the game, at the same time. The run being “only” around 30 minutes is expected. A run in Hades typically takes top level players about 13-17 minutes, but that’s on speedrun difficulty (read: low difficulty settings focussed around going faster). 64 heat has a built-in time constraint in which you will take damage for every second you go over the timer. The timer is 5 minutes per biome and any leftover time gets carried over, meaning you have 20 minutes to complete a run. This timer is based on in game time. The in game timer pauses during menus, shopping, chamber loads and many more. That’s why on the end screen the run is shown below 20 minutes, but the real time is ~30.

    The run she did here wasn’t the first unseeded run she completed, but the first unseeded AND unmodded run to be cleared. She is one of two people in the world to have cleared a modded unseeded run. Her modded run was 13 days ago, but took over a year of grinding. Modded 64 heat is how she honed her skills to be able to do this unmodded as well. The gameplay and difficulty is similar, but the RNG is much tougher in unmodded. This run was 1 in a million but sometimes you just get the run!
